Born in Germany but raised in the United States, Gustave Baumann (1881–1971) supported his family as a young man by working for a commercial engraving house. In 1918 Baumann moved to the American Southwest, where he would become an integral part of the Santa Fe artists’ community. For more than fifty years he captured the crystalline light and rich colors of the landscape with affection, grace, and subtlety. This calendar presents twelve of Baumann’s woodcuts—self-contained, self-possessed small worlds that speak to the heart of simplicity.
